🚀 Contender v0.3.0 выпущен! Вот что нового в нашем инструменте для стресс-тестирования Ethereum:🧵
🔧 Умное управление ошибками и более безопасные конфигурации Асинхронные задачи теперь правильно возвращают ошибки, что упрощает отладку. Мы также добавили дополнительное отслеживание, чтобы разработчики могли проверять асинхронные задачи во время выполнения в tokio-console.
🔥 Новые встроенные сценарии Contender теперь может симулировать: - Заполнение блока газом - Спам с опкодами и предкомпиляциями - Затопление слотов хранения - Переводы ETH - Обмены UniV2 - Полные стресс-тесты (всё в одном спаме)
📊 Улучшенная отчетность - Измеряет задержку eth_sendBundle - Обрабатывает отсутствующие трассировки tx корректно - Отчеты теперь включают откатывающиеся tx
🆕 Поддержка Prague & Engine API V4 Contender может создавать блоки с последними нагрузками выполнения после Prague, используя аутентифицированный engine_ API.
👥 Гибкий контроль над аккаунтом Новый флаг -a позволяет вам выбрать, сколько аккаунтов будет финансироваться и отправлять спам, больше не привязан к TPS.
🧪 Важные изменения и улучшения под капотом Callback traits теперь возвращают Result AuthProvider::new/from_jwt_file требует message_version Обновления зависимостей (reth, alloy) Чище паттерны обратных вызовов
1,34K